Role: Cloud Network Lead/Architect Location: Mountain View, CA Duration: 12 Months We are seeking a highly skilled Senior Cloud Networking Engineer to design, implement, and optimize networking solutions across our cloud environments. You will be responsible for ensuring secure, scalable, and high-performing network connectivity for our global systems. This role will partner closely with cloud, DevOps, and security teams to deliver reliable cloud networking architectures that meet the needs of a growing, mission-critical platform. Cloud Networking Design & Implementation • Architect and maintain networking solutions in AWS and Google Cloud Platform including VPCs, subnets, routing, peering, and hybrid connectivity. • Design and configure load balancing, API gateways, private service access, and service meshes for modern application environments. • Implement and manage cloud-based firewalls, NAT, VPNs, and SD-WAN Security & Compliance • Enforce network security best practices, including zero-trust principles, segmentation, and encryption in transit. • Partner with the security team to monitor for vulnerabilities, misconfigurations, and potential threats. • Support compliance requirements (SOC 2, ISO 27001, HIPAA, GDPR, etc.) through secure network design. Operations & Troubleshooting • Lead advanced troubleshooting of network connectivity, latency, and throughput issues. • Build automation scripts and Infrastructure-as-Code (Terraform, Pulumi, etc.) for network provisioning. • Maintain observability and monitoring tools to ensure health and reliability of network services. • Provide on-call support for critical infrastructure networking issues. Responsibilities: 10+ years of experience in network engineering, with at least 5+ years in cloud networking. Deep knowledge of AWS VPC networking, Google Cloud Platform VPC & VPC-SC, or Azure Virtual Networks. Strong background in routing, BGP, DNS, firewalls, and load balancing in cloud and hybrid environments. Experience with Kubernetes networking (CNI, service mesh, ingress/egress). Proficiency with Infrastructure as Code (Terraform, Pulumi, or CloudFormation). Familiarity with security tools, monitoring, and observability (Datadog, Prometheus, ELK, etc.). Excellent problem-solving, communication, and cross-functional collaboration skills.
